HUB hero image

How to Travel from

San Diego to Mesa

by Plane, Rideshare, Route or Car

San Diego
+0
Mesa
Transport search to Mesa
San Diego
+0
Mesa
Building a composite car route
Cheapest
Best Offer!
Car
6 h 4 min
595 km.
from $32
Composite Route Car Only

Three ways to Travel from San Diego to Mesa

Select an Option Below to Start Your Journey
Cheapest
Fastest
Other

Transport providers

Airlines

American Airlines

Website:
aa.com/
Plane from San Diego International Airport to Phoenix
Ave. Duration:
1h 28m
Frequency:
Every day
Estimated price:
$153.08–$612.33

Frontier Airlines

Website:
flyfrontier.com/
Plane from San Diego International Airport to Phoenix
Ave. Duration:
1h 23m
Frequency:
Every day
Estimated price:
$53.58–$204.11

Southwest Airlines

Website:
southwest.com/
Plane from San Diego International Airport to Phoenix
Ave. Duration:
1h 20m
Frequency:
Every day
Estimated price:
$127.57–$433.73

Bus operators

Greyhound USA

Phone:
+1 214-849-8100
Website:
greyhound.com/
Bus from El Cajon Transit Center to Phoenix
Ave. Duration:
6h 50m
Frequency:
5 times a week
Estimated price:
$28.07–$204.11

CBX Cross Border Express

Website:
crossborderxpress.com/en/
Bus from Cross Border Express, San Diego to Phoenix
Ave. Duration:
11h 15m
Frequency:
Twice daily
Estimated price:
$89.30–$127.57

Valley Metro

Phone:
+1 (602) 253-5000
Website:
valleymetro.org
Train from 44th St/Washington to Center/Main
Ave. Duration:
41 min
Frequency:
Every 20 minutes
Estimated price:
$2.31

Questions and Answers

What is the cheapest way to get from San Diego to Mesa?

The cheapest way to get from San Diego to Mesa is to drive which costs $65.22 - $97.83 and takes 6h 6m.

What is the fastest way to get from San Diego to Mesa?

The fastest way to get from San Diego to Mesa is to fly and tram which takes 3h 34m and costs $50 - $163.04 .

How far is it from San Diego to Mesa?

The distance between San Diego and Mesa is 516 km. The road distance is 596.3 km.

How do I travel from San Diego to Mesa without a car?

The best way to get from San Diego to Mesa without a car is to bus which takes 9h 48m and costs $28.26 - $195.65 .

How long does it take to get from San Diego to Mesa?

It takes approximately 3h 34m to get from San Diego to Mesa, including transfers.

Can I drive from San Diego to Mesa?

Yes, the driving distance between San Diego to Mesa is 596 km. It takes approximately 6h 6m to drive from San Diego to Mesa.

Where can I stay near Mesa?

There are 2572+ hotels available in Mesa. Prices start at $58.95 per night.
+0